Utah Security Deposit Laws 2026
Here's what Utah law says about security deposit returns, deadlines, and penalties. All information is sourced from UT Code § 57-17-1 to 57-17-5.
Return Deadline
30 calendar days
from move-out date to return your deposit
Penalty for Violations
Actual damages sustained
Itemization Requirements
- Itemized statement required: Yes
- Itemization deadline: 30 days
- Receipts required: No
Interest Requirements
Not required. Your landlord does not have to pay interest on your deposit.
Statute of Limitations
- Written lease: 6 years
- Oral lease: 4 years
Small Claims Court
Maximum claim: $11,000
Attorney fee shifting available — you may recover attorney fees if you win.
